How to Convert Gram-Force/sq. Centimeter to Kilopascal

1 gf/cm^2 = 0.0980665 kPa

Example: convert 15 gf/cm^2 to kPa:
15 gf/cm^2 = 15 × 0.0980665 kPa = 1.4709975 kPa

Gram-Force/sq. Centimeter

Gram-force per square centimeter (gf/cm²) is a unit of pressure representing the force exerted by one gram-force applied over an area of one square centimeter.

History/Origin

The unit originated from the use of gram-force, a non-SI unit of force based on the gram, and was commonly used in engineering and scientific contexts before the adoption of SI units. It was primarily used in regions and industries where the metric system was prevalent.

Current Use

Today, gf/cm² is largely considered obsolete and is rarely used in modern scientific or engineering applications. Pressure measurements are typically expressed in pascals (Pa) or bar, but the unit may still appear in legacy systems or specific niche contexts.


Kilopascal

The kilopascal (kPa) is a unit of pressure equal to 1,000 pascals, where one pascal is defined as one newton per square meter.

History/Origin

The kilopascal was introduced as part of the metric system to provide a convenient unit for measuring pressure, especially in scientific and engineering contexts, replacing larger units like the bar in many applications.

Current Use

The kilopascal is widely used today in various fields such as meteorology, engineering, and physics to measure pressure, including tire pressure, blood pressure, and atmospheric pressure.
